## Formula sandbox tuning

User-supplied formulas in Gridmoor execute inside a restricted interpreter with hard ceilings on time, memory, and call depth. Reviewers should confirm any change to these ceilings is justified in the PR description, since raising them widens the abuse surface. Defaults were chosen from production traces. The current limits are as follows.

limits module of tafog-fawip:
WEIGHTS = {
    "julix": 57,
    "lamys": 992,
    "kasvan": 209,
    "quenok": 750,
    "alddor": 259,
    "oliath": 1009,
    "wenix": 815,
}

Subject: Marwick Components — Contract Renewal

Team: the Marwick Components agreement lapses end of quarter. They want a 7% uplift; we're countering at 3% with a two-year term and volume rebates tied to the Ashgrove line. Legal has the redline. Sales leads: hold pricing conversations with shared accounts until this closes. Decision needed by Friday's exec call. No external mention of alternative suppliers. The confidential rationale for our position follows directly below.

internal memo for taguf-kafop: Novmirax Group plans to lower the Oliius list price by 42.0 percent in March. The board signed off on a budget of $367.8 million for Project Belael. The renewal with Drumirax Logistics closes at $302.4 million a year, 54.0 percent below the last contract. Project Kelys slips by a full year because of the staffing delay.

## Who to ping about GiftNote

Welcome aboard! GiftNote is our donation-receipt mailer for the Larchfield Fund. Template tweaks go to the comms folks; delivery failures and bounce weirdness go to the platform crew. Don't push template changes on Fridays — receipts batch over the weekend. For anything GiftNote-related, start with the address below.

billing contact of kaweg-tajeg = drudor.lamion.oliath@torvalabs.test